44 migrants disembark in Malta

Some 40 migrants were brought to Malta on Monday morning following a transfer from the NGO vessel Open Arms to a patrol boat of the Armed Forces of Malta.

The group was brought to Malta and disembarked at the Armed Forces naval base in Hay Wharf, Floriana.

The 44 migrants include 13 minors and two women, one of whom is pregnant, according to Times of Malta.

They were picked up by a rescue ship operated by Open Arms on Saturday night after being alerted by migrant hotline Alarm Phone of a wooden boat in distress.

The migrants were rescued from a dinghy in the Maltese search-and-rescue region.
